Specialists of the Center for Humanitarian Demining and Special Works have completed work on the survey of the sections of the existing quarry. Shells and ammunition from the Second World War were found.

December 22, 2023

The staff of the Center for Humanitarian Demining and Special Works participated in the inspection of the territory for the presence of explosive objects (VOP), their subsequent removal and destruction on the land allocated for the development of a quarry for the construction of multi-storey residential buildings.

As a result of the work explosive objects were found during the Great Patriotic War.

Artillery and mortar shells from the Great Patriotic War are mainly among the discovered weapons.

All explosive objects found were removed from the surveyed areas and destroyed in strict accordance with all regulations.

Expert’s comment:
Searches for explosive objects from the Great Patriotic War and their destruction are regularly carried out in the Leningrad Region. This is due to the fact that some of the fiercest clashes took place here. Even despite the continuous demining carried out in the first post–war years, land owners often find unexploded shells and mines during land works – the earth “pushes” them to the surface. Therefore, a survey of the territory at the initial stages of construction for the presence of a VOP will allow you to avoid related problems in the future.
